The investment objective is to generate long-term capital growth from a diversified and actively managed portfolio of equity and equity related securities and to enable investors a deduction from total income, as permitted under the Income Tax Act, 1961 from time to time. However, there can be no assurance that the investment objectives of the Scheme will be realized. The Scheme does not guarantee/indicate any returns.
The JM Tax Gain Fund - Growth has an AUM of 222.93 crores & has delivered CAGR of 14.40 in the last 5 years. The fund has an exit load of 0.00% and an expense ratio of 2.10%. The minimum investment in JM Tax Gain Fund - Growth is Rs 500 and the minimum SIP is Rs 500.
As per morningstar the risk & return rating of the fund are Medium & Exceptional respectively.
The fund has a present cash holding of %. The top holdings of the fund include Syrma SGS Technology, HDFC Bank, Reliance Industries, ICICI Bank.
The major sectors where the fund is invested are Consumer Financial Services, Regional Banks, Electronic Instr. & Controls, Software & Programming.
